Computing triadic generators and association rules from triadic contexts

In this paper, we present a set of algorithms to display a Hasse diagram of triadic concepts in Triadic Concept Analysis and compute triadic generators and association rules, including implications without any need for a preprocessing step to convert the triadic representation into a dyadic one. Our contributions are as follows. First, we adapt the iPred algorithm for precedence link computation in concept lattices to the triadic framework. Then, new algorithms are proposed to compute triadic generators by extending the notion of faces to further calculate association rules. Finally, an empirical study is conducted in order to mainly show the performance of our prototype on triadic contexts and estimate the cost of each one of its components.
